PrestaShop Login By User Name | User Name Sign in – Signup

€19.60
€49.00
Save 60%
Tax excluded

Hurry up

Empower your customers to log in seamlessly with either their username or email address using the Username Module. With automatic username generation from email addresses, this feature simplifies account access and enhances user experience. Additionally, admins have the flexibility to easily add or modify usernames from the backend.

Technical Support
Quantity
  Return policy

10-day module exchange guarantee

  • Enable customers to log in using either a username or email address, offering enhanced flexibility, improved user experience, and better security for every sign-in session.

  • Simplify account access by supporting both username and email-based login, providing users with an easier, more versatile way to log into their PrestaShop account.

  • This module enhances usability by allowing customers to choose between username or email login, making the sign-in process faster, smoother, and more user-friendly.

  • Provide dual sign-in options to improve user accessibility and reduce login failures caused by forgotten usernames or emails, leading to a better overall customer experience.

  • Automatically generate unique usernames based on customer emails, helping to streamline the sign-up process while ensuring each account has a distinct and valid identifier.

  • With the option to recover usernames, customers can easily regain account access without needing to contact support, improving platform reliability and user satisfaction.

  • Admins gain full control over username format, field visibility, and default values, making the registration experience customizable and aligned with business needs.

  • Support seamless integration with existing systems and user databases by enabling email and username login without requiring major structural or data model changes.

  • Give customers the power to view or update their usernames anytime within their account panel, supporting full control over login credentials and personalization.

  • A robust and flexible module offering security, convenience, and full login control, ensuring both customers and admins benefit from simplified and secure access management.

  • Customers can log in using either their email address or a unique username, offering flexibility and convenience during the login and registration processes.

  • The module automatically generates usernames from customer emails, ensuring uniqueness and reducing manual input errors during sign-up.

  • Admins can set minimum and maximum character lengths for usernames, helping enforce standardization and avoid conflicts or overly long identifiers.

  • Customers can easily recover forgotten usernames using the “Forgot Username” feature, eliminating login frustration and improving account recovery flow.

  • Admins have the ability to create, edit, or manage usernames from the back office, offering full backend control over user login credentials.

  • Registration forms can include or exclude first and last name fields based on admin preference, simplifying or customizing sign-up as needed.

  • Customers can view and update their usernames directly in the "My Account" area, promoting personalization and user control over account data.

  • The module is compatible with standard PrestaShop login mechanisms, ensuring seamless operation without disrupting core authentication functionalities.

  • The module includes installation and configuration instructions with a readme file, helping admins quickly set up and activate username login functionality.

  • Full integration with existing databases ensures login compatibility, reducing technical friction when migrating or syncing user data across platforms.

  • Users enjoy login flexibility by choosing between email or username, making account access faster and more convenient for various preferences and memory styles.

  • Username-based login gives customers a familiar, personalized login experience, particularly for those who prefer using custom identifiers over standard email addresses.

  • Enhanced security by requiring a password with either email or username reduces the risk of unauthorized access and strengthens account protection.

  • Users no longer worry about forgotten usernames; the built-in recovery feature lets them retrieve their login name instantly without external help.

  • Simplified sign-up with auto-generated usernames ensures faster registration, encouraging more sign-ups and reducing user friction during the account creation process.

  • Editable usernames empower users to personalize their login credentials, fostering a sense of ownership and a more tailored customer experience.

  • Login errors are reduced thanks to the option of using either username or email, leading to fewer support requests and higher satisfaction.

  • Customers can register quickly without filling unnecessary fields if admins disable first/last name, saving time and enhancing mobile or quick-signup experiences.

  • Dual login methods make it easier for users who use email across platforms or prefer shorter usernames for quicker login on different devices.

  • Improved accessibility ensures that users who forget one login method (email or username) can still access their account with the alternate method.

  • Download the module ZIP file and upload it in PrestaShop through the “Modules > Module Manager > Upload a module” interface in the back office.

  • Click the “Install” button after uploading. PrestaShop will install the module and show a confirmation once the installation completes successfully.

  • Go to the configuration page of the module to enable username-based login and adjust additional settings as needed.

  • Activate the setting that allows customers to log in using a username in addition to their email and password.

  • Set username rules such as minimum and maximum length, allowed characters, and auto-generation preferences based on customer email.

  • Customize the registration form by choosing to show or hide the first name and last name fields. Set default values if hiding them.

  • Enable the option that lets customers view and edit their username from the “My Account” section in the front office.

  • Access the “Customers” section in the admin panel to manually view, add, or update usernames for any registered customer.

  • Test the signup and login process on your storefront to ensure both email and username login methods function properly.

  • Review the module’s README file for advanced setup instructions, troubleshooting tips, and compatibility notes for different PrestaShop versions.

Can customers log in using both email and username?Yes, customers can choose to log in using either their email address or a unique username, based on what they prefer.
How is the username created during registration?Usernames are automatically generated from the customer’s email address using the first 20 characters to ensure uniqueness and simplicity.
Can customers change their username later?Yes, customers can view and update their username anytime directly from the “My Account” section in the front office.
What if a customer forgets their username?The module includes a “Forgot Username” feature that helps customers recover their username by email quickly and securely.
Can I hide the first and last name fields on the signup form?Yes, admins can disable first and last name fields in the registration form and set default values if needed.
Will the module affect existing customers?No, existing customers remain unaffected. They can continue logging in using their email or add a username optionally.
Is it possible to set validation rules for usernames?Yes, admins can define minimum and maximum character lengths and apply custom rules for username formatting in the backend.
Can admins create or edit usernames in the back office?Yes, administrators can create, update, and manage usernames for all customers from the admin Customers section.
Does this module work with third-party login modules?The module is designed for PrestaShop’s default login system. Compatibility with third-party modules may require testing

Customer reviews

5 Out Of 5
5 star
100%
4 star
0%
3 star
0%
2 star
0%
1 star
0%

Top reviews




Operational Benefits of Login By User Name Module

Faster Login

Improved Accessibility

Enhanced Security

Flexible Access

Efficient Recovery

Reduced Errors

Core Features of Login By User Name Module

Dual Login Support

Allows customers to log in using either their email address or a unique username. This flexibility improves user experience and reduces login failures caused by forgotten email addresses or usernames.

Username Recovery Option

Includes a “Forgot Username” feature that helps customers recover their username via email. This reduces customer frustration and support requests while improving overall account accessibility.

Admin Username Control

Admins can create, edit, or view usernames from the back office. This gives store managers full control over customer credentials, helping to manage accounts efficiently.

Custom Validation Rules

Set minimum and maximum username length or apply specific validation rules. This ensures consistency and prevents invalid usernames from being created during customer registration.

Editable Customer Usernames

Customers can view and update their username anytime from the “My Account” section. This flexibility improves personalization and account control from the user side.

Optional Name Fields

Admins can hide or display first and last name fields on the registration form. This helps simplify signup or comply with store policies and localization needs.

Power Up Your rESTASHOP Store — We Handle It All​

Related products